Aging Artfully

Discover the joy of printmaking in a welcoming, creative community. Each month, participants explore a different printmaking technique using high-quality, non-toxic materials in our fully equipped studio.

This program is open to adults of all experience levels—from complete beginners to experienced artists. Support persons and companions are always welcome.

Participants may register for individual sessions or attend as many as they like.If you have any accessibility needs or questions, please contact us at registrar@munroecenter.org.

This program began with support and generous grant from the Dana Home Foundation, whose mission is to promote the care, comfort, and well-being of older adults, with a special emphasis on serving those who reside in or have connections to the Town of Lexington.
